You ought to consider having a stamp made at Staples or wherever that reads something like:
"California compliant certificate attached." Or: "California compliant acknowledgement or jurat attached."
Stickies are notorious for falling off and ending up at the bottom of the FedEx/UPS envelope, never to be seen.
Also, a stamp is more professional, not to mention you don't have to fill out the stickies anymore!
Also, do you have a CA jurat stamp? I think NR sells them. They make quick work out of noncompliant jurats, so you don't have to attach a separate loose-leaf; and there's usually room on the doc. |
